National Trench Safety (NTS) is a pivotal organization dedicated to ensuring the safety and security of workers involved in trenching and excavation operations. Recognized for its comprehensive approach to safety, NTS provides a wide array of services, including safety training, equipment rental, and expert consultation, to address the inherent risks associated with trenching and excavation work. This article serves as a guide to understanding NTS's mission, offerings, and how they contribute to creating safer worksites across the nation.
The core mission of NTS is to reduce the risk of accidents and injuries in trenching and excavation operations through education, innovation, and support. By focusing on the latest safety technologies and best practices, NTS aims to elevate industry standards and ensure that every worker returns home safely at the end of the day.
